This means you really only have to remember the password or passphrase that unlocks the password manager. Not only does using one make it harder for hackers to hack into your accounts, it also makes your life easier as password managers help you create and store unique passwords. As we explain in the Motherboard Guide to Not Getting Hacked, using a password manager is a must.
